子宫肌瘤与肌肉组织雌孕激素受体含量与月经周期及子宫内膜组织相关系的探讨

摘    要:应用放射受体分析法测定40例子宫肌瘤患者子宫肌瘤、肌肉组织雌激素受体(ER)、孕激素受体(PR)的含量,月经周期根据月经史及子宫内膜组织相来判断,比较两种组织ER、PR含量与月经周期及子宫内膜组织相的关系。结果:子宫肌瘤组织的ER、PR含量高于同一子宫正常肌层的含量(P<0.05);子宫肌瘤与肌肉两种组织中ER含量在子宫内膜增殖期高于分泌期(P<0.025,P<0.05),PR含量分泌期高于增殖期(P<0.025)。23例有正常月经周期者,15例与子宫内膜组织相符合,8例与子宫内膜组织相不符合。15例无正常月经周期者,子宫内膜组织相多为增殖期改变,占80%。提示:子宫肌瘤的发生、发展与雌、孕激素及其受体含量有关,孕激素在肿瘤发生、发展中可能起协同作用,提示抗孕激素治疗子宫肌瘤的可能性。

A study on the estradiol and progesterone receptor in uterine myoma and normal myometrium and on their relations to the endometrial cycle.

Abstract:\ Objective:To study the correlation among estradiol and pregesterone receptors,uterine myoma and endometrial cycle.Design:The contents of estradiol receptor(ER) and progesterone receptor(PR) were determined in 40 myoma specimens obtained from patients during performing hysterectomy because of myoma and were compared with those in the normal myometrium using radioimmunoassay.Their endometrial cycle were also analysed.Result:The ER concentration in myomas was significantly higher than that in myometrium.The ER concentration in both the myoma and the myometrium during the proliferative phase was significantly higher than that in the secretory phase while the PR concentration was lower.Conclusion:The contents of ER and PR are related to the genesis of uterine myoma and the progesterone may play a cooperation role during the development of uterine myoma.
